The Reasons Why Pre Purchase Building Inspections Are Crucial

Excellent, you’ve found one that looks like it meets all the criteria. A real estate agent believes it is solidly built and your DIY professional friend believes it’s fine. Are you required to get it checked out?

If you purchase a home without performing a pre inspection prior to purchase and you find yourself with some expensive problems that could be identified, but you may be severely limiting your options for claiming damages in the event that the house ended up with significant issues.

A pre purchase building inspection report by an certified Waiwhetu building inspector will identify any problems the property has, as well as any future problems and highlight areas to add value. It will make sure that house buyers do not face any nasty unexpected costs and gives you an opportunity to negotiate lower price.

We examine the entire structure and look for any serious flaws as well as any future or urgent maintenance issues or problems caused by the gradual loss of quality. We are looking for structural issues or signs that the house has a leaky structure, issues caused by deferred maintenance like weatherboards becoming rotten due to peeling paint and areas that are damp or mould.

Red Flags & Warning Signs

The following issues could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ic pipe: Look for them if your home was constructed or rebuilt between the late 1970s and the early 1980s. They have been known to leak. Insurers are unlikely cover damage caused by this pipe, in the event that you knew they were there.

Weathersideexterior cladding: This weatherboard can leak. If the house was built in the 80s, it could have Weatherside.

Cladding made of Plaster: It was popular from the 1980s and into the mid-2000s many "leaky houses" have this cladding. Exterior walls generally are smooth or unbroken surface.

Asbestos products: Widely used since the mid-1940s until the mid-1980s. It can be found on ceilings, roofs, under lino, fencing. If asbestos is found at the property, seek expert advice on what risk it presents, how it might be removed, the time it would be to get rid of, and the cost of removal.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Waiwhetu

Our detailed pre-purchase inspection will pinpoint any areas which may need urgent attention.

  • An in-depth assessment of the structure and weather-tightness of all visible components.
  • An assessment of the solutions for the building (given reasonable access).
  • A brief survey of out-buildings, immediate grounds and site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ing for areas with high-risk and potential problems such as window and door penetrations and rooms that are wet (bathrooms laundry, etc.) is part of the core services offered.
  • Identification of maintenance related items.
  • Recognising alterations and additions post construction that was originally constructed, requiring a permission or approval.
